MsSql存储优化与触发器实战指南
|
在实际应用中,MsSql存储优化是提升数据库性能的重要环节。合理的存储结构设计可以减少数据冗余,提高查询效率。例如,通过规范化和反规范化技术,可以根据业务需求平衡数据一致性和查询速度。
AI生成3D模型,仅供参考 索引的使用对存储优化至关重要。合理创建索引能够加快数据检索速度,但过多或不恰当的索引会增加写入成本。建议对经常用于查询条件的列建立索引,并定期分析查询计划以优化索引结构。 触发器是数据库中一种自动执行的特殊存储过程,常用于维护数据完整性或实现业务逻辑。当表中的数据发生变化时,触发器可以自动执行预定义的操作,如更新相关表或记录日志。 在使用触发器时,需要注意避免复杂的逻辑导致性能下降。例如,在触发器中进行大量数据操作或嵌套触发器可能会引起死锁或性能瓶颈。应尽量保持触发器逻辑简洁,必要时可将复杂逻辑移至应用程序层处理。 测试和监控是确保触发器和存储优化有效性的关键步骤。可以通过SQL Server Profiler或动态管理视图(DMVs)来跟踪触发器的执行情况,分析其对系统性能的影响。 备份和恢复策略也需考虑存储优化后的结构。确保在数据变更频繁的场景下,备份方案能够快速恢复,并且不影响正常业务运行。 本站观点,MsSql存储优化与触发器的结合使用,可以有效提升数据库的稳定性和性能,但需要根据具体业务场景进行细致规划和持续优化。 (编辑:开发网_新乡站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330465号